Sudan Nashra: Security incidents prompt review of military-allied joint force role in cities | Military captures key RSF logistical hub in West Darfur, moves within reach of Geneina | Weeklong border impasse ends for South Sudanese on ‘voluntary return’ ferry, so

Security incidents in Sudan have prompted a reassessment of the role played by a military-allied joint force in urban areas. The Sudanese military has captured a critical logistical hub belonging to the Rapid Support Forces (RSF) in West Darfur, bringing them closer to the city of Geneina. Meanwhile, a week-long border standoff between Sudan and South Sudan has ended, with South Sudanese individuals returning voluntarily via ferry. These developments reflect ongoing tensions and shifting dynamics in the region.
